Scotland striker Che Adams has agreed a contract in principle at Torino and is set for a medical on Monday.

The 28-year-old is expected to sign a multi-year deal in Italy after his contract at promoted Southampton expired at the end of June.

The Serie A club are believed to beaten Premier League clubs to Adams’ signature, with Wolves having reportedly been interested.

Adams scored 17 goals in 46 games as Southampton were promoted back to the Premier League by beating Leeds in the play-off final.

He also played a part in all three of Scotland’s Euro 2024 matches in Germany in June.
